About natural gas
The Parliament adopts this organic law.
This law shifts:
- Article 1-42, 44-48, and also appendix I to the Directive 2009/73/EU of the European parliament and Council of July 13, 2009 about general rules of the domestic market of natural gas and cancellation of the Directive 2003/55/EU published in the Official magazine of the European Union by L 211 of August 14, 2009 in the option adapted and approved by the Decision of Council of Ministers of Energy community No. 2011/02/MC-EnC of October 6, 2011;
- Articles 2, 5, 6c, 7, 9, 10 and appendix III to Regulations (EU) 2017/1938 of October 25, 2017 the European parliament and Council about measures for guaranteeing safety of supply of gas and about cancellation of Regulations (EU) No. 994/2010, of the European Union published in the Official magazine of L 280 of October 28, 2017, in the option adapted and approved by the Decision of Council of Ministers of Energy community No. 2022/01/MC-EnC of September 30, 2022;
- articles 1-3a, 13, 15-22, 24 and appendix I to Regulations (EU) No. 715/2009 of July 13, 2009 the European parliament and Council about conditions of access to gas transmission networks and cancellation of Regulations (EU) No. 1775/2005, of the European Union published in the Official magazine of L 211 of August 14, 2009, in the option adapted and approved by the Decision of Council of Ministers of Energy community No. 2011/02/MC-EnC, and No. 2022/1032 changed by Regulations (EU) of June 29, 2022 the European parliament and Council about modification of regulations (EU) No. 2017/1938 and No. 715/2009, published in the Official magazine of the European Union by L 173 of June 30, 2022 in the option adapted and approved by the Decision of Council of Ministers of Energy community No. 2022/01/MC-EnC of September 30, 2022;
- Articles 3, 6, 10, 12, 14, 17-20 and 34 Regulations (EU) No. 2017/460 of the Commission of March 16, 2017 about approval of the Network code concerning the harmonized structures of rates for gas transportation, the European Union published in the Official magazine L 72 of March 17, 2017, in the option adapted and approved by the Solution of the Standing group of high level of Energy community No. 2018/07/PHLG-EnC of November 28, 2018;
- Regulations (EU) No. 1227/2011 of October 25, 2011 the European parliament and Council about fair behavior of participants and transparency of wholesale energy market published in the Official magazine of the European Union by L 326 of December 8, 2011 in the option adapted and approved by the Decision of Council of Ministers of Energy community No. 2018/10/MC-EnC of November 29, 2018.
(1) the Purpose of this law is: creation of the general legal basis of the organization, regulation, ensuring effective functioning and monitoring of the sector of the natural gas designed to supply consumers with natural gas in the conditions of availability, availability, reliability, uninterruptedness, quality and transparency; providing open entry to the natural gas market; ensuring adequate balance between the demand and supply, proper power level of networks of natural gas, including intersystem capacity; market development of natural gas and integration into the competitive market of natural gas; determination of the measures designed to guarantee safety of supply with natural gas; establishment of obligations on rendering public service and ensuring their proper accomplishment; ensuring compliance with the rights of consumers, and also regulations on environmental protection.
(2) fall Under operation of this law:
a) production of natural gas;
b) transfer of natural gas, including cross-border flows of natural gas;
c) distribution of natural gas;
d) storage of natural gas;
d-1) trading in the sector of natural gas;
e) supply of natural gas;
f) sale of the compressed natural gas for vehicles at gas stations;
g) determination and approval of regulated prices for natural gas, and also the regulated rates connected with access to networks of natural gas, installations for storage, and other regulated rates for the services provided by the gas companies according to this law;
h) licensing of types of activity in the natural gas market;
i) organization, functioning and market monitoring of natural gas and access to this market, and also ensuring conscientiousness and transparency of the natural gas market;
j) organization, functioning and monitoring of system of natural gas;
k) safety and stability of providing final consumers with natural gas;
l) access to public or private property for the purpose of construction, operation, servicing, recovery or upgrade, including technological retrofitting, networks of natural gas;
m) regulated access for the third parties to networks of natural gas.
n) consumer protection.
(3) For the purpose of implementation of innovative test platforms in the field of regulation in power the owner of the resolution on approval uses departures from application of provisions of this law on condition of observance of procedures, stipulated by the legislation about innovative test platforms in the field of regulation in power, and also on condition of ensuring protection and safety of the population.
The basic concepts used in this law mean:
access to storage – the right of the user of system to perform downloading and selection of natural gas in amounts and during the periods specified in the service provision agreement on storage, by use of installations for storage in accordance with the terms, established by this law;
access to network – the right of the user of system, including the final consumer to take away and deliver natural gas in amounts and during the periods specified in the service provision agreement on transfer, in the service provision agreement on distribution, by use of the transferring networks of natural gas, distribution networks of natural gas in accordance with the terms, established by this law;
access to the ascending networks of natural gas – the right of the user of system to use the ascending networks of natural gas, except for parts of these networks and installations used for local production operations in production sites of natural gas;
бэкхол – the transaction with natural gas including appointment and supply distribution of natural gas in the direction opposite to the main physical flow of natural gas, performed in intersystem Items;
capacity – the maximum flow expressed in units of volume or in energy units per unit of time to which the user of system has the right in accordance with the terms of the service provision agreement on transfer of natural gas;
contractual capacity – capacity which the operator of the transferring system marked out to the user of system in accordance with the terms of the service provision agreement on transfer of natural gas;
capacity of consumption – consumption of natural gas by the final consumer when its installation / installation of consumption work at full capacity. This capacity includes all amount of natural gas consumed by the corresponding final consumer considered as single business entity if such consumption happens in the markets to interdependent wholesale prices. In case of application of this concept consumption of natural gas in the certain places of consumption which are belonging to the same final consumer and having power consumption less than 600 GW H/year is not considered if appropriate places of consumption do not exert general impact on the prices in the wholesale market of natural gas owing to the geographical arrangement in the different significant markets;
free capacity – part of technological capacity which is not allocated yet and which still is available for system at the appropriate time;
the guaranteed capacity – capacity of the transferring network of natural gas, the installation for storage guaranteed by the operator of the transferring system, the operator installation for storage as continuous;
the interrupted capacity – capacity which can be interrupted by the operator of the transferring system in accordance with the terms of the service provision agreement on transfer of natural gas;
not used capacity – the guaranteed capacity acquired by the user of system according to the service provision agreement on transfer of natural gas but not declared by the user of system till the deadline specified in the relevant agreement;
technological capacity – the maximum guaranteed capacity which can be offered by the operator of the transferring system, the operator installation for storage to users of system taking into account need of ensuring integrity of system and need of observance of requirements for operation of the transferring networks of natural gas, installation for storage;
certification – the procedure within which observance by the operator of the transferring system, the operator of installation for storage of the requirements concerning their department and independence and also other major requirements imposed to the operator of the transferring system, the operator of installation for storage by this law and which is the precedent condition of appointment of the operator of the transferring system, the operator of installation for storage by licensing is considered;
the direct gas pipeline – the gas pipeline, additional in relation to the connected networks of natural gas;
overload – provision in case of which the network of natural gas cannot cope with all physical flows of natural gas resulting from the transactions requested by participants of the natural gas market because of absence or shortage of capacity of the relevant transferring networks of natural gas;
contractual overload – provision in case of which level of demand on the guaranteed capacity exceeds technological capacity;
physical overwork – provision in case of which at a given time level of demand on the actual deliveries exceeds technological capacity;
overconsumption of natural gas – daily consumption of natural gas in the cold season (from October to March) exceeding minimum for 20 percent the level of average daily consumption, celebrated during the cold climatic periods, statistically probable time in 20 years, is consequence of what emergence of imbalance in the transferring network of natural gas;
the consumer – the wholesale or final consumer or the gas company buying natural gas;
the wholesale consumer – physical person – the individual entrepreneur or the legal entity buying natural gas for resale in or out of system of natural gas;
the residential customer – the physical person buying natural gas for own domestic needs which are not connected with its commercial use for implementation of business or profesyosionalny activity;
the authorized consumer – the consumer of natural gas who is freely choosing the supplier from whom he buys natural gas;
the final consumer – the residential customer or not residential customer buying natural gas for own consumption;
industrial consumer – not residential customer acquiring and using natural gas in engineering procedure for production of industrial output and/or consumer goods, and also for production of electrical and heat energy;
not residential customer – the physical person or legal entity buying natural gas for other purposes than own domestic needs;
socially vulnerable consumer – the residential customer determined according to regulations in the field of social protection as vulnerable person or the member of vulnerable family;
the protected consumers are the residential customers and other categories of consumers answering to the conditions and criteria established in Regulations on emergency situations in the sector of natural gas;
the operational account of balancing – the account between operators of the adjacent transferring systems used for management of difference of the direction of flow to intersystem Item for the purpose of simplification of accounting of natural gas for the users of system concerning intersystem Item;
the delivery agreement of natural gas – the agreement on the basis of which natural gas is delivered to the consumer, but who does not turn on the derivative tool of natural gas;
the long-term agreement on supply of natural gas – the delivery agreement of natural gas signed for the term of more than 10 years;
the service provision agreement on transfer of natural gas – the agreement signed between the operator of the transferring system and the user of system for the purpose of implementation of supply of natural gas on the transferring networks of natural gas;
control over the company – the rights, agreements or other means which everyone separately or all together with accounting of the corresponding legal or actual circumstances give opportunity to exert decisive impact on the company, in particular, through the property rights or uses to all assets of the company or their part and/or the rights or agreements exerting decisive impact on structure of the company, vote or decisions of its governing bodies;
selection level – level, on which the user of system using installation for the storage having the right to make selection of natural gas from corresponding installation for storage;
downloading level – level, on which the user of system using installation for the storage having the right to make pumping natural gas in corresponding installation for storage;
installation for storage – the equipment used for storage of natural gas, belonging to the gas company and/or operated by it, except for the equipment used for production and the equipment intended only to the operator of the transferring system for accomplishment of the functions by it;
development of distribution network of natural gas – increase in capacity of the existing distribution network of natural gas or construction of new distribution networks or sites of distribution networks of natural gas;
development of the transferring network of natural gas – increase in capacity of the existing transferring network of natural gas or construction of the new transferring networks or sites of the transferring networks of natural gas;
distribution of natural gas – transportation of natural gas on distribution networks of natural gas for the purpose of its delivery to consumers or in points of commercial measurement of other operators of distributive systems, not including delivery;
the measuring equipment – the equipment or system for measurement of amount or amount of the delivered natural gas and in need of consumption of natural gas for the purpose of invoicing;
outsourcing of service or work – the conclusion the owner of the license with the third party of the service provision agreement or performance of work which it shall make according to this law and conditions of the license without license concession to the third party;
cross-border flow of natural gas – flow of the natural gas transferred in the course of import, export and/or transit through intersystem Items of the transferring systems of natural gas belonging to several states;
supply of natural gas – sale, including resale, natural gas to consumers;
the supplier – the gas company owner of the license for supply of natural gas delivering natural gas according to this law;
the supplier as a last resort – the supplier who in the context of obligations on rendering public service is appointed during the limited period of time to deliver natural gas to the final consumers who lost owing to certain circumstances of the supplier on the regulated special conditions established by this law;
the compressed natural gas for vehicles (SPGT) – the natural gas which is saved up in cylinders by compression up to the pressure over 20 MPas for its use in fuel quality for vehicles with internal combustion engines;
management of overload – portfolio management of capacities of the operator of the transferring system or the operator installation for storage for the purpose of optimum and maximum use of technological capacity and advance identification of points of peak and maximum loads;
exact information – information in which it is specified set of circumstances which came or concerning which there are reasonable grounds to believe that they will come, and also on event which took place or concerning which there are reasonable grounds to believe that it will take place and which is rather true to draw conclusion on possible influence of all circumstances or events on the price of energy products of the wholesale market;
internal information – exact information which was not promulgated directly or indirectly concerns one or several energy products of the wholesale market and which in case of its promulgation can significantly influence the price of energy products of the wholesale market. For the purposes of this concept information means the following:
a) information which is subject to disclosure according to this law, Regulations on access to the transferring networks of natural gas and management of overloads, the Code of networks of natural gas, and also according to Rules of the natural gas market;
b) information on capacity and use of installations of consumption, production installations, installations for storage or the transferring networks of natural gas, including information on their planned or unplanned unavailability;
c) information which is subject to disclosure according to provisions of regulations or agreements in the wholesale market of natural gas if this information can have significant effect on the price of energy products of the wholesale market;
d) other information relating to the natural gas market which the participant of the market can use for decision making about implementation of the transactions connected with energy product of the wholesale market or about making the trade order concerning such product;
confidential information on protection of critical infrastructure – information on critical infrastructure in the value determined by the Law on the prevention and fight against terrorism No. 120/2017 which in case of disclosure can be used for the purpose of planning and implementation of the actions leading to removal it out of operation or to its destruction;
gas installation of the final consumer – installation for connection and consumption installation;
production installation – complex of the equipment and the pipelines of the producer necessary for natural gas production as natural mineral or for production of natural gas in the artificial way with reduction of parameters of natural gas to compliance with the normative requirements provided for its delivery to network of natural gas;
installation for connection – gas installation by means of which the network of natural gas contacts production installation, installation for storage or consumption installation, including the SPGT installation;
installation for underground storage – installation for storage which belongs and/or is operated by the gas company is used for storage of natural gas, including balancing inventories, and is connected to the transferring or distribution network, except for land spherical reservoirs or the storage which is built in in the pipeline;
consumption installation – complex of gas installations of the final consumer, held for use natural gas, including the SPGT installation;
the derivative tool of natural gas – the financial instrument designed to insure participants of the natural gas market against possible price fluctuations on natural gas in the market in case this tool belongs to the sector of natural gas;
integrity of system – condition of the transferring network of natural gas, distribution network of natural gas, installation for storage, including the related installations in case of which pressure and quality of natural gas do not go beyond the set minimum and maximum limits, so that transfer, distribution or storage of natural gas were technically guaranteed;
intersystem connection – the gas pipeline crossing border between the Republic of Moldova and other country for the single purpose – connection of the national transferring systems of natural gas of the Republic of Moldova and the respective country;
the gas company – the physical person or legal entity in accordance with the established procedure registered in the Republic of Moldova as the company, performing at least one of types of activity on production, transfer, distribution, storage, trading or supply of natural gas and performing commercial, technical functions and/or service functions in connection with the specified types of activity, but without participation of final consumers;
the integrated gas company – horizontally or vertically integrated gas company;
horizontally integrated gas company – the gas company performing at least one of types of activity on production, transfer, distribution, storage, trading or supply of natural gas, and also another, not connected with the sector of natural gas, activities;
vertically integrated gas company – the gas company or group of the gas companies as a part of which or as a part of which the same person or the same persons has the right to carry out directly or indirectly control as it is determined by this law and which or which perform at least one of types of activity on transfer, on distribution or on storage of natural gas and at least one of types of activity on production, on trading or on supply of natural gas;
the related company – the affiliated company which has the majority of voting powers at other company and/or the right to appoint or recall most of members of governing bodies of other company and which at the same time is participant, the founder of this company and/or which under the agreement with other participants, founders of this company controls voting powers in its structure; and/or dependent enterprise in relation to the dominating company; and/or the associate having significant effect on financial and managerial policy of other company; and/or the company which is under the influence of other company; and/or the companies belonging to one and those/same participants, founders; and/or economic societies which, without depending from each other, are joint under single management or are controlled the bodies consisting in the majority the of the same persons; and/or other types of affiliated economic societies;
the place of consumption – location of gas installations of the final consumer where by means of one installation of consumption the gas delivered through one or several installations for connection is spent;
management of energy efficiency and/or demand – integrated or complete approach for the purpose of influence on amount and capacity, correctness of planning of consumption of natural gas for decrease in consumption of natural gas and amounts of natural gas from peak sources by provision of priority to investments into actions for energy efficiency or into other measures, such as agreements on the interrupted supply of natural gas, to investments into increase in production capacity if they are the most effective and economic options taking into account the positive environmental impact exerted by economical consumption of natural gas, on safety of supply with natural gas, and also on the costs for service in distribution of natural gas connected with these measures;
method of establishment of the basic price – the calculation method applied to that part of the income received from provision of services on transfer of natural gas which is subject to compensation for the account of regulated rates for service in transfer on the basis of capacity, for the purpose of determination of basic prices;
method of establishment of the basic price depending on the weighted average distance on the basis of capacity – the calculation method established as basic method according to the Code of networks of natural gas;
the request – the prior notice the user of system of the operator of the transferring system or the operator installation for storage about the actual amount of gas which the user of system intends to enter into system or to select from it;
task on creation of inventories of natural gas – the task, obligatory for accomplishment, connected with the inventory level of natural gas in relation to cumulative capacity of installations for underground storage, determined for member countries of Energy community or member states of the European Union in which there are installations for underground storage;
the obligation on rendering public service – the short-term obligation assigned to the gas company in general economic interests which can concern safety, including safety of supply with natural gas, uninterruptedness, quality, the prices of deliveries, and also environmental protection and which shall not be discrimination and shall not distort the competition, except that which is strictly necessary for implementation of the obligation on rendering this public service;
the operator of installation for storage – the gas company having the license for storage of natural gas performing activities for storage of natural gas and operating installation for storage;
the operator of the SPGT installation – the legal entity in accordance with the established procedure registered in the Republic of Moldova as the company, being the owner of the license for sale of the compressed natural gas for vehicles at gas stations, performing the activities connected as with storage of natural gas in reservoirs by its compression up to the pressure over 20 MPas for the purpose of its further sale for use in fuel quality for vehicles with internal combustion engines;
the operator of distributive system – the gas company – the owner of the license for distribution of natural gas which owns distribution networks of natural gas performs functions on distribution of natural gas and is responsible for operation, servicing, upgrade, including technological retrofitting, and development of distribution networks of natural gas in certain zones, and also for providing long-term capability of distribution networks of natural gas to meet reasonable demand for provision of service in distribution of natural gas;
the operator of the transferring system – the gas company owner of the license for transfer of natural gas which owns the transferring networks of natural gas performs functions on transfer of natural gas and is responsible for operation, servicing, upgrade, including technological retrofitting, and development of the transferring networks of natural gas and intersystem connections, and also for providing long-term capability of the transferring networks of natural gas to meet reasonable demand for provision of service in transfer of natural gas;
the system operator – the operator of the transferring system and the operator of distributive system;
quality parameters – set of the characteristics of natural gas established in the quality standards which affirm national authority on standardization and are specified afterwards as obligatory in the regulating regulations approved by National regulation agency in power;
the member of Energy community – the agreement party about Energy community;
the participant of the natural gas market – physical person or legal entity, including the system operator, performing transactions with natural gas, including by placement of the trade order in the wholesale market of natural gas;
the natural gas market – the organized sphere of purchase and sale of natural gas by participants of the market and provision of system services for the purpose of uninterrupted and reliable providing consumers with natural gas within system of natural gas;
the primary market – the market of the capacity sold directly by the operator of the transferring system or the operator installation for storage;
the secondary market – the market of the capacity sold differently than in the primary market;
long-term planning – planning on long-term basis of necessary investments into production capacities and capacities on storage, in the transferring and distribution networks of natural gas for the purpose of satisfaction of system demand for natural gas, diversifications of sources and guaranteeing uninterrupted supply of natural gas to consumers;
the basic price – the price of product of the guaranteed capacity with effective period one year which is applied on entrance and output Items and is used for establishment of regulated rates for services in transfer of natural gas on the basis of capacity;
the producer – the gas company owner of the license for the production of natural gas performing activities for gas production as natural mineral in the territory of the Republic of Moldova or making gas in the artificial way;
energy products of the wholesale market – the following agreement types and derivative tools, irrespective of the place or method of their sale:
a) delivery agreements of natural gas in case of implementation of delivery to the Republic of Moldova or to member countries of Energy community, member states of the European Union;
b) service provision agreements on transfer of natural gas in the Republic of Moldova or in member countries of Energy community, member states of the European Union;
c) delivery agreements and provision of service in distribution of natural gas to final consumers who have capacity of consumption over 600 GW H/year;
differentiating Item – the place in which gas installations of the final consumer are differentiated on the basis of the property right from networks of natural gas, installations of the gas company, or the place in which are differentiated on the basis of the property right of network of natural gas, installation of the gas companies;
connection point – physical point of network of natural gas to which are connected by means of installation for connection production installation, installation for storage or consumption installation, including the SPGT installation;
connection – accomplishment of installation by the system operator for connection of the applicant – the potential final consumer, except the operator of the SPGT installation, and/or connection and start-up under pressure of gas installations of the final consumer, the SPGT installation, production installation or installation for storage on condition of creation of the acceptance act of these installations;
the repeated request – the subsequent notification on the corrected request;
distribution network of natural gas – the system consisting of gas pipelines with the working pressure of gas to MPa 1,2 inclusive with the gas control Items and other installations located behind point of connection to the transferring network of natural gas and, on circumstances, to installations for storage, to production installations which serves for distribution of natural gas;
network of natural gas – the transferring and distribution network of natural gas;
the ascending network of natural gas – any network of natural gas operated and/or constructed within the project of production of natural gas or used for transfer of natural gas from one or several production sites of this kind to the overworking device or to the terminal or port terminal;
the transferring network of natural gas – the system consisting of gas pipelines with the working pressure of gas over MPa 1,2 with compressor, gas distribution, gas-measuring stations and other installations which serves for transfer of natural gas, except the ascending networks of natural gas;
safety – safety of delivery and delivery of natural gas, and also technical safety;
additional services – the services accompanying transfer or distribution of natural gas, provided to users of system and the third parties by the system operator according to this law, Regulations on connection to networks of natural gas and provision of services on transfer and distribution of natural gas and the Code of networks of natural gas on the basis of the rates approved by National regulation agency in power according to methodology of calculation, approval and application of regulated rates for additional services;
system services – the services necessary for ensuring access to the transferring and distribution networks of natural gas, installations for storage, and also for their operation, including services of balancing, mixing and input of natural gas, but not concerning the installations intended to the operator of the transferring system for accomplishment of the functions by it;?
services in transfer of natural gas like бэкхол – complex of the actions and transactions which are carried out by the operator of system of transfer for or in connection with:
a) allocation of the transferring capacity on type бэкхол;
b) provision of services on transfer of natural gas like бэкхол on the basis of the contractual transferring capacity in the interrupted mode through intersystem Item;
the interrupted services – the services provided by the operator of the transferring system, the operator installation for storage in connection with the interrupted capacity;
long-term services – the services offered by the operator of the transferring system, the operator installation for storage for the term of one year and more;
short-term services – the services offered by the operator of the transferring system, the operator installation for storage for the term of less than one year;
the closed distributive system – the system authorized in accordance with the terms, established by this law, distributing natural gas in geographically limited zone – industrial, commercial or public;
system of natural gas – production installations, installation for storage, the ascending networks of natural gas transferring and the distribution networks of natural gas belonging to the gas companies and operated by them, adjacent installations necessary for ensuring access to the transferring and distribution networks of natural gas, and also to installation for storage;
the joint system – set of the transferring and distribution networks of natural gas connected among themselves by means of one or several intersystem connections;
lump-sum system – calculation method of scoping of the consumed gas proceeding from nominal consumption of natural gas gas devices and hourly time of their use or from the heated area; it is applied in terms and on the conditions provided by the law;
emergency situation in the sector of natural gas – unexpected situation which at the national level can lead to imbalance between demand for natural gas and its offer, caused:
a) decrease in amount of the imported natural gas more than for 20 percent of demand for it;
b) registration within seven days in a row of extremely low temperatures on all or in the considerable territory of the country during the cold climatic periods, statistically probable time in 20 years that leads to overconsumption of natural gas;
small enterprises – the companies in the sense determined in the Law on the small and medium companies No. 179/2016;
gas distribution station – complex of installations for regulation of pressure, measurement of expense, filtering and odorization through which natural gas from the transferring networks of natural gas is delivered in network of natural gas of adjacent system operators, gas installations of final consumers, including in installations of operators of the SPGT installations;
gas control Item – complex of installations for the regulation of pressure, measurement of pressure, temperature, expense, filtering connected by means of branch to distribution network of natural gas through which natural gas from networks of high or average pressure is transferred to distribution networks of natural gas with lower level of pressure and/or to consumption installations;
balancing inventory – amount of not liquefied natural gas, which:
a) it is bought, controlled and stored in installations for underground storage by operators of the transferring systems or the subject appointed only for accomplishment of functions of operators of the transferring systems and safety of supply with natural gas; and
b) it is used only in case it is necessary for maintenance of safe and reliable system operation of natural gas;
the reserve stock – amount of the not liquefied natural gas which is stored in installations for storage which is bought, controlled and stored by the subject appointed for creation and maintenance of reserve stocks according to Article 1081, and can be used in accordance with the terms, provided by part (8) the specified Article;
storage of natural gas – complex of the works and actions which are carried out by the gas company for storage or in connection with stock holding in storages and for downloading to storages, storages in them and selection from them of natural gas in certain quantities;
storage in the pipeline – storage of natural gas by its compression in the transferring and distribution networks of natural gas, excepting the installations intended to the operator of the transferring system for accomplishment of the functions by it;
cross subsidies – the direction of income gained during implementation of one type of activity or in connection with certain category of consumers users of system on covering of the expenses or losses suffered by the same gas company when implementing other type of activity or in connection with other categories of consumers users of system;
rate for connection – the regulated rate established according to the methodology approved by National regulation agency in the power engineering specialist who is paid to the system operator by the applicant – the potential final consumer, except for of the operator of the SPGT installation for the purpose of covering of the expenses connected with designing, accomplishment of installation for connection, connection to network of natural gas and start-up under pressure of gas installations of the final consumer, except for the SPGT installations;
rate for start-up under pressure – the regulated rate established according to the methodology approved by National regulation agency in the power engineering specialist who is paid to the system operator by the applicant for covering of expenses on connection to network of natural gas and start-up under pressure of gas installations of the final consumer if its installation for connection was not executed by the system operator, the SPGT installations, production installation or installation for storage;
regulated rate for service in transfer of natural gas – the rate approved by National regulation agency in power which users of system shall pay the operator of the transferring system for the services in transfer of natural gas provided to them;
attempt of market manipulation – one of the following actions:
1) transaction or making the trade order of rather energy products of the wholesale market with intention:
a) make obviously false declarations or mislead concerning the offer, demand or the price of energy products of the wholesale market;
b) in the artificial way to establish the price of one or several energy products of the wholesale market if only the person who made the transaction or gave the trade assignment was not convinced that the reasons which induced to arrive thus, are absolutely legal and that such transaction or such order correspond to the market practice accepted in the natural gas market;
c) by means of the dummy tool or by any other form of deception or confidence abuse to transfer or try to transfer the untrue or misleading information on the offer, demand or the price of energy products of the wholesale market;
2) distribution of information through mass media, including the Internet, or any other method with intention to transfer the untrue or misleading messages concerning the offer, demand or the price of energy products of the wholesale market;
the trader – being the owner of the license for trading activities in the sector of natural gas the gas company performing activities in the procedure provided by the law;
trading of natural gas – purchase and sale of natural gas in the wholesale market of natural gas, including in connection with import/natural gas export;
transfer of natural gas – transportation of natural gas on the transferring networks of natural gas for the purpose of its delivery to final consumers, not including delivery;
the user of system – physical person or legal entity which performs delivery in system of natural gas or to which delivery from system of natural gas is performed;
the conservation zone of networks of natural gas – the zone, adjacent to networks of natural gas, with special conditions of use established along the pipeline route and around other objects of network of natural gas within which according to Regulations on conservation zones of networks of natural gas ban on access for people, on carrying out certain works and the mode of construction for the purpose of providing normal service conditions and exception of possibility of damage of networks of natural gas are imposed.
(1) According to this law natural gas is made, transferred, distributed, is stored, delivered and consumed in the most effective way.
(2) Regulating tasks of this law are:
a) ensuring sustainable development of national economy;
b) the ensuring safe, reliable and effective functioning of system of natural gas designed to guarantee uninterrupted supply of natural gas and requirements satisfaction in natural gas of final consumers with observance of parameters of quality and the established quality indicators and also provision of system and additional services;
c) the organization and ensuring functioning of the national natural gas market in the conditions of transparency, competition and nondiscrimination, its integration into the regional and European market, and also creation of necessary conditions for ensuring the competition at the natural gas market;
d) providing to all physical persons and legal entities of regulated and non-discriminatory access to the transferring and distribution networks of natural gas, installations for storage, and also open and non-discriminatory entry to the natural gas market;
d-1) ensuring conscientiousness and transparency of the natural gas market, including by determination of obligations of participants of the wholesale market of natural gas on registration and publication of internal information with observance of the conditions provided by this law, way of introduction of prohibitions on market manipulation and on transactions, based on internal information and also by determination of the special powers of the National agency on regulation in power connected with investigation of potential abuses in the wholesale market of natural gas and possible transactions based on internal information;
e) determination of functions of the National agency on regulation in power, the rights and obligations of the gas companies, relations between the gas companies, and also their relations with the National agency on regulation in power;
e-1) promotion in the sector of natural gas of the regulation based on stimulation;
f) forming of the necessary legal basis for regulation and monitoring of the actual department of the operator of the transferring system, the operator of distributive system and the operator of installations for storage, and also ensuring their independence of the gas companies performing activities for production or supply of natural gas;
g) creation of necessary conditions for implementation of adequate investments in system of natural gas, including for ensuring sufficient capacities on production of natural gas, storage of natural gas, sufficient capacities of the transferring and distribution networks of natural gas, intersystem connections necessary for steady and smooth functioning of system of natural gas, and also for safety of supply with natural gas;
h) assistance to cross-border exchange of natural gas on the basis of accurately certain, transparent and non-discriminatory mechanisms of allocation of capacities and management of overloads for the purpose of effective use of intersystem capacities, and also promotion of diversification and competition in case of natural gas import;
i) determination of conditions of accomplishment of obligations on rendering public service in the sector of natural gas and ensuring protection of final consumers;
j) establishment of measures for safety of supply with natural gas of final consumers;
k) increase in efficiency and decrease in negative impact of activities in the sector of natural gas on the environment, and also assistance to development of this sector according to economic, nature protection and social policy of the state;
l) ensuring regional and international cooperation of operators of the transferring systems and National regulation agency in power, and also cooperation between competent authorities of the state;
m) providing in case of investigation of potential abuses in the wholesale market of natural gas of the Republic of Moldova and possible making of the transactions which are based on internal information capable to make cross-border impact, cooperation of the National agency on regulation in power with other regulating authorities in case of approval of the Regulating committee of Energy community.
(1) for the purpose of ensuring steady functioning and development of the sector of natural gas the Government:
a) determines the priority directions and state policy in the sector of natural gas, including taking into account need of decrease in harmful effects of the sector of natural gas on the environment;
b) provides taking into account need of long-term planning creation of necessary premises for stable development and functioning of the sector of natural gas;
c) approves the energy strategy and program documents, the stipulated in Article 7-2 Laws on power No. 174/2017;
d) approves the Regulations on conservation zones of networks of natural gas developed by the central industry body of public management in the field of industrial safety and also the regulations developed by the central industry body of public management in the field of power;
e) approves Regulations on emergency situations in the sector of natural gas, the Action plan in emergency situations in the sector of natural gas, structure and special powers of the Commission on emergency situations of the Republic of Moldova, and also performs by means of the central industry body of public management in the field of power monitoring of observance of provisions of this law on safety of supply with natural gas;
f) accepts resolutions on entering into Parliament of the offer on the announcement of emergency state according to the Law on the modes of emergency, obsidional and warlike situation No. 212/2004;
g) according to the appeal of the National agency on regulation in power according to part (8) Article 15 creates the companies performing activities for transfer, storage, distribution or supply of natural gas in the context of the obligations established by Articles 89 and 90 on rendering public service;
h) assigns to the gas companies of the obligation for rendering public service according to this law, including stipulated in Clause 108-2 obligations on rendering public service;
i) provides realization of policy of development and use of gas fields of the Republic of Moldova and grants according to industry regulations right to use by subsoil plots for natural gas production;
j) makes the decision on financing from means of the government budget of construction of the transferring networks of natural gas, intersystem connections;
k) accepts resolutions on construction of installations for storage of natural gas in amount of more 0,1 of one million cubic meters, and also on arrangement for these purposes of natural reservoirs;
l) provides protection of socially vulnerable consumers by means of the program of the public assistance in limits of the financial resources which are available in the government budget or other methods, except the state intervention in price fixation on supply of natural gas;
m) within available means of the government budget takes measures for temporary compensation of increase in prices to residential customers according to Article 84-1;
n) advances interests of the sector of natural gas at the international level and signs the international agreements, including for the purpose of increase in energy security of the state and ensuring supply with natural gas.
(2) the Government ensures energy security of the state, safety of supply with natural gas by means of approval of program documents, the regulations specified in Item е) parts (1), and also by realization of other necessary measures provided by this law.
(2-1) Government take necessary measures for ensuring use till November 1 of each calendar year of capacities on storage of natural gas in installations for storage of other member countries of Energy community, member states of the European Union which correspond to the level at least 15 percent of annual average consumption of natural gas by the final consumers of the Republic of Moldova connected to networks of the natural gas of licensed system operators determined for the period, consisting of the last five calendar years. The inventories of natural gas which are subject to creation for this purpose include the inventories provided by Articles 108-1-108-3.
(3) the Government provides interaction at the different levels for the purpose of approval administrative the practician in the sector of natural gas and promotion of regional and international cooperation in the sector of natural gas.
(4) the Government performs also other functions established by this law and the Law on power No. 174/2017.
(1) Organa of local public authority permissions for construction of objects of system of natural gas according to the Law on permission of accomplishment of construction works No. 163 of July 9, 2010 issue, on demand.
(2) In case of issue of permissions for construction of apartment houses, buildings and other constructions bodies of local public authority shall observe the requirements to conservation zones of networks of natural gas established by Regulations on conservation zones of networks of natural gas.
(3) Organa of local public authority are responsible for project development of construction of distribution networks of natural gas of the local value performed based on the permissions to connection issued by operators of distributive systems and according to town-planning plans and plans of arrangement of the territory and also represent the corresponding projects to operators of distributive systems.
(4) Earth, the states which are in public property and administrative and territorial units, are transferred on a grant basis to use to operators of the transferring systems, operators of distributive systems for production of necessary works on construction and/or operation of networks of natural gas.
(1) the Body given authority on regulation and monitoring of activities in the sector of natural gas is the National regulation agency in power (further – the Agency).
(2) the Agency will be organized, controlled and financed according to the Law on power.
(3) the Agency performs the activities in the sector of natural gas according to this law, the Law on power and the Regulations on the organization and functioning of the National agency on regulation in power approved by Parliament.
(The Agency develops 4), represents to Parliament and places on the official web page the activities report for previous year according to the procedure and the terms established by the Law on power.
(1) in the field of regulation of the activities in the sector of natural gas which are subject to regulation by licensing and permission, the Agency:
a) issues, prolongs, renews, stops, resumes action or withdraws licenses, issues them copies and duplicates according to this law and the Law on regulation of business activity by permission No. 160/2011;
b) appoints the owner of the license who will perform the licensed activities instead of the owner of the license for transfer of natural gas, distribution of natural gas, storage of natural gas or supply of natural gas in the context of the obligations on rendering public service established by Articles 89 and 90, whose license is suspended, withdrawn or overdue;
c) performs monitoring of observance by owners of licenses of the obligations established by this law concerning quality of the provided services and efficiency of the performed activities, and also other established conditions of implementation of the licensed activities;
d) will certify the operator of the transferring system and performs monitoring of permanent observance by it of requirements for department and independence, and also provided by this law of other requirements;
e) performs monitoring, in case of appointment of the independent system operator, the relations and exchange of information between the owner of the transferring networks of natural gas and the independent system operator, and also observance of the obligations established by this law by them;
e-1) requests information and reports from the independent system operator and the owner of networks of natural gas and performs, including sudden, in the location of the owner of the transferring network, as well as in the location of the independent system operator;
f) approves agreements, agreements between the candidate for operators / the independent system operator and owners/owners of the transferring networks of natural gas, including lease agreements, or the resolutions establishing contents of the relevant agreements in provided by part (6) Articles 26 cases;
